Review of Wembley Stadium

30 May 08, 11:55

Finally..... 5*

Well it took long enough but let me say, it was well worth the wait.

I went to the Community Shield here last season and it was superb. Unlike the old Wembley, they have real toilets so you don't have to go up against the wall. They also have proper seats and not benches like before so eveyrone has a good view. Some bits are VERY steep so it looks a bit like matchstick men.

The walk from the station brings back memories, a great day out and even better if your team wins...

Review of Axe & Cleaver

20 May 08, 11:22

Absolutely stunning 5*

Everything about the Axe and Cleaver is brilliant. The location down a country lane in the beautiful Dunham, the food, the staff...all perfect.

This is a typical country pub but a big one at that. There is plenty of outside space for the rare British summer's day. It's really tranquil outside and a great place to go just for a drink or for some food. The food is actually as good as the place itself, superb. All freshly cooked and a real selection on the menu. You can't leave without trying a dessert which will leave you feeling really full but satisfied.

The staff are friendly, it's a family run pub on a large scale, everyone is there to make your experience a great one.

Review of Dutch Pancake House

20 May 08, 10:47

A pancake for dinner?? Surely not 5*

Believe it because it's happening, you're going out for dinner and you're other half takes you to somewhere called the Dutch Pancake House?! You might wonder what is going, I will tell you...s/he loves you and wants to introduce you to one of the best eateries Manchester has to offer.

The building is inconspicuous, it's not changed for years, everything around it has changed. The cinema has gone, there are new bars and some weird tram thing called the Metrolink has appeared, what hasn't changed is the quality of the food.

So how does it work!? Well you walk down the stairs to the basement restaurant trying to ignore the horrendous orange and yellow walls, until you reach the restaurant itself, breathe in...the smell is incredible (unless there are a bunch of sweaty teenagers in there in which case I apologise for suggesting you breathe in). When you think of pancakes as a meal you might imagine you get a stack of pancakes on a plate, WRONG. What you do get is a piece of art. A huge pancake, thick but not stodgy, either with sweet things on like the basic sugar and lemon, chocolate spread, syrup etc OR you can have the savoury ones, now these are the real gems. You can have all varieties of meats and veg, think pizza but on a pancake and not just ON the pancake but actually cooked INSIDE the pancake, i know...sounds amazing doesn't it?!! You must try the traditional DUTCH pancake which is bacon and maple syrup!!

So how about the price? Well it's amazingly reasonable. You only pay a couple of quid for the sugar and lemon basic pancake and up to a limit of £7 for the meat feast, it's not going to break the bank at all.

If you're off to the theatre or a show in town then this is a great quick place to eat and it's different, it's not Italian or Chinese, it's just plain different and sometimes you know, different is good!
